Key Features Comparison
Understanding the differences in features between HDFC Credila and InCred can help you decide which lender aligns with your needs.
| Feature | HDFC Credila | InCred |
|---|---|---|
| Interest Rate | Starts at 9.5% (subject to profile) | Starts at 10% (subject to profile) |
| Loan Amount | Up to INR 50 lakhs | Up to INR 40 lakhs |
| Processing Fee | 1% of loan amount | 1-2% of loan amount |
| Repayment Period | Up to 10 years | Up to 8 years |
| Collateral Requirement | Often required | Generally optional |

Costs, Rates, and Fees
The costs associated with education loans can vary significantly based on the lender, your financial profile, and the course you're pursuing.
HDFC Credila
HDFC Credila typically offers competitive interest rates. However, keep an eye on the processing fees, which can be around 1% of the loan amount. This upfront cost might impact your total loan expenditure.

Step-by-Step Process
Step 1: Calculate Your Requirement
Determine the exact amount you need for your course, including tuition, living expenses, and travel if you're studying abroad.
Step 2: Research Lenders
Investigate both HDFC Credila and InCred. Compare their rates, terms, and eligibility criteria based on your personal profile and course requirements.
Step 3: Prepare Documentation
Gather all necessary documents, such as admission letters, income proof, and academic records. Both lenders require detailed documentation for loan approval.
Step 4: Submit Application
Apply directly through the lender's website or visit a local branch. Ensure all your information is accurate to avoid delays.
Step 5: Await Approval
Both Credila and InCred have relatively quick processing times. Keep an eye on your email or phone for updates.
